Method and system for controlling an application feature based on system metrics
Computer-implemented methods, systems, and computer program products for controlling application feature processing based on central processing unit (CPU) usage and/or feature requirement to apply the application feature are disclosed. The computer-implemented method for controlling application feature processing based on central processing unit (CPU) usage to apply the application feature includes monitoring system metrics for availability of system resources; determining availability of system resources required to perform the particular application feature; determining if the particular application feature is to be applied based on the determination of the availability of system resources; and applying the particular application feature based on results of the determination of the availability of system resources.
1 . A method comprising:
monitoring, by a processing system including a processor, system metrics for availability of system resources during a first monitoring period, wherein the system resources include processing power, memory or a combination thereof;
based on the system metrics, determining, by the processing system, that availability of system resources required to perform a first application feature satisfies a first system resource threshold associated with the first application feature during the first monitoring time period resulting in a first determination;
applying, by the processing system, the first application feature based on the first determination;
suspending, by the processing system, the monitoring of the system metrics for the availability of system resources for a sleep mode time period;
upon expiration of the sleep mode time period, monitoring, by the processing system, the availability of system resources for a second monitoring time period;
based on the system metrics, determining, by the processing system, that the availability of system resources required to perform the first application feature does not satisfy a second system resource threshold associated with the first application feature during the second monitoring time period resulting in a second determination, wherein the first system resource threshold is less than the second system resource threshold;
deactivating, by the processing system, the first application feature based on the second determination; and
applying, by the processing system, a second application feature based on the second determination.
